码迷,mamicode.com
首页 >  
搜索关键字:smp    ( 515个结果
用户线程和内核线程
1.内核级线程:切换由内核控制,当线程进行切换的时候,由用户态转化为内核态。切换完毕要从内核态返回用户态;可以很好的利用smp,即利用多核cpu。windows线程就是这样的。用户态转化为内核态的时候需要进行上下文的切换,是耗时的操作,因为有寄存器值的保存装载,内存缓存的失效和载入,中断程序的执行等。 2. 用户级线程内核的切换由用户态程序自己控制内核切换,不需要内核干涉,少了进出内核态...
分类:编程语言   时间:2014-12-08 23:05:08    阅读次数:334
erlang 虚机crash
现网服务,每次更新一个服务时,另外一个集群所有node 都跟着同时重启一遍,这么调皮,这是闹哪样啊。。 看系统日志:/var/log/messages Oct 30 15:19:41 localhost kernel: beam.smp[21880]: segfault at 7fa300...
分类:其他好文   时间:2014-12-07 11:20:56    阅读次数:363
Debian 下 Vbox 只显示 32 位系统
在Debian下安装完Vbox,结果创建虚拟机,发现只有32 bit的version。 如下图:   实际上,操作系统和Vbox 的安装包,装的都是64 bit。root@dave:/usr/bin# uname -aLinux dave 3.2.0-4-amd64 #1 SMP Debian3.2.63-2 x86_64 GNU/Linu...
分类:其他好文   时间:2014-12-05 15:34:35    阅读次数:218
boot空间不足
1,查看当前的内核信息uname -a Linux liudong 3.13.0-39-generic #66-Ubuntu SMP Tue Oct 28 13:30:27 UTC 2014 x86_64 x86_64 x86_64 GNU/Linux2, 查看系统中已安装的内核列表dpkg --g...
分类:其他好文   时间:2014-11-28 09:52:20    阅读次数:180
漫话NUMA
在DPDK中,使用了NUMA技术,来提高CPU对内存的访问效率.那么什么是NUMA呢,它是如何提高CPU访问内存的效率的呢?首先,我们先明确几个概念,即,SMP、NUMA、MPP。它们是目前主流的计算机系统架构。SMP(Symmetric Multi-Processor):对称多处理结构。在这样的系...
分类:其他好文   时间:2014-11-20 21:35:27    阅读次数:249
1《大话操作系统——做坚实的工程实践派》(8.1)(指令集未完待续)
大多数情况,操作系统内核用纯C语言是写不了的,因为有些关键功能,重要代码段,还是得用汇编指令干上一把才行, 本书不会过于详细的介绍ARM920T处理器所有的指令以及每条指令所有的详细使用方式。因为,一、篇幅所限,二、本书不是介绍某一特定处理器的指令集的专著。但是也不用害怕,笔者会尽量做到写操作系统内核时足够使用。...
分类:其他好文   时间:2014-11-20 12:03:13    阅读次数:144
Linux内核的idle进程分析
1. idle是什么简单的说idle是一个进程,其pid号为 0。其前身是系统创建的第一个进程,也是唯一一个没有通过fork()产生的进程。在smp系统中,每个处理器单元有独立的一个运行队列,而每个运行队列 上又有一个idle进程,即有多少处理器单元,就有多少idle进程。系统的空闲时间,其实就是指...
分类:系统相关   时间:2014-11-17 13:56:02    阅读次数:285
抢占式内核与非抢占式内核中的自旋锁(spinlock)的区别
一、概括 (1)自旋锁适用于SMP系统,UP系统用spinlock是作死。 (2)保护模式下禁止内核抢占的方法:1、执行终端服务例程时2、执行软中断和tasklet时3、设置本地CPU计数器preempt_count (3)自旋锁的忙等待的实际意义是:尝试获取自旋锁的另一个进程不断尝试获取被占用的自旋锁,中间只pause一下! (4)在抢占式内核的spin_lock宏中,第一次关抢占,目的...
分类:其他好文   时间:2014-11-14 12:37:57    阅读次数:287
SMP、NUMA、MPP体系结构介绍
从系统架构来看,目前的商用服务器大体可以分为三类,即对称多处理器结构 (SMP : Symmetric Multi-Processor) ,非一致存储访问结构 (NUMA : Non-Uniform Memory Access) ,以及海量并行处理结构 (MPP : Massive Parallel...
分类:其他好文   时间:2014-11-12 19:45:42    阅读次数:303
Linux内核的idle进程分析
1. idle是什么   简单的说idle是一个进程,其pid号为 0。其前身是系统创建的第一个进程,也是唯一一个没有通过fork()产生的进程。在smp系统中,每个处理器单元有独立的一个运行队列,而每个运行队列上又有一个idle进程,即有多少处理器单元,就有多少idle进程。系统的空闲时间,其实就是指idle进程的"运行时间"。既然是idle是进程,那我们来看看idle是如何被创建,又具体做了...
分类:系统相关   时间:2014-11-12 10:37:42    阅读次数:232
515条   上一页 1 ... 44 45 46 47 48 ... 52 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!